A selection of choons from the Gerry McAvoy Band of Friends "Celebrating the music of Rory Gallagher".  Coming your way soon.  Cambridge Junction 18th May 2012.

 

Gerry McAvoy (bass) was with him for over 20 years and played on every one of Rory's studio albums, Ted McKenna (ex-Sensational Alex Harvey Band etc) was part of the late '70s/early 80s line up, which I had the pleasure of seeing a number of times.  For example, Ipswich Gaumont (now Regent) January 1979:

 

(Taken on an old Zenit E/50mm lens - remember those, built like a T-34 tank!)

 

With the sadly no longer with us Rory of course being the main man, I wasn't sure I wanted to go and see them with a stand-in guitarist.  But having watched a few of these choons, you know, I think I just might...  It is, after all, a celebration of Rory's music, not a tribute band.
